Analysis

In 2018, kuwait — sawnwood, coniferous — export value in Canada stood at 1,510 1000 USD.

The figure is down 15.8% on the previous year and down 15.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, kuwait — sawnwood, coniferous — export value in Canada peaked at 6,364 1000 USD in 2010 and was at its lowest, 57 1000 USD, in 2002.

Canada ranks 7th of 26 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
